Revelation Perth International Film Festival to screen 116 films

NEW DELHI: The annual Revelation Perth International Film Festival opened with the breathtaking sci-fi film Under The Skin featuring Scarlett Johansson. Special guests of the festival included Sonic Youth’s Lee Ranaldo and Australian actor Aaron Pedersen (Mystery Road, Water Rats, City Homicide) alongside national and international filmmakers, musicians, screen artists, academics and distributors.

 

Revelation has established itself as an international film festival, making it a fertile ground for independent filmmakers, distributors and discerning audiences.

 

"Rev has come a long way over the years" said festival founder and director Richard Sowada at the opening, adding that "After the huge amount of work that has been put in over time, it is enormously gratifying to see the event cement its place as the key annual screen culture event in WA." (Western Australia)

 

Revelation is supported by the Australian and west Australian governments through ScreenWest, TourismWA and Screen Australia. The Festival will come to an end on 13 July at the Luna Cinema in Leederville, Perth, Western Australia.
